Jim McLachlan Politician

James Robert McLachlan is a former Canadian politician, who represented the electoral district of Faro in the Yukon Legislative Assembly from 1985 to 1989 and from 2001 to 2002. He was a member of the Yukon Liberal Party, and the party's leader from 1986 to 1989.He became the party's interim leader after the resignation of Roger Coles due to criminal charges.
